300mA, Ultra-Low Noise, Ultra-Fast CMOS LDO Regulator **Introducing the RT9193-15PU5: A High-Performance LDO Regulator for Precision Applications**  

In today’s fast-evolving electronics landscape, stable and efficient power management is critical for ensuring optimal performance in compact and power-sensitive designs. The **RT9193-15PU5** stands out as a reliable low-dropout (LDO) voltage regulator, delivering a fixed 1.5V output with exceptional accuracy and efficiency.  

Designed for applications requiring minimal noise and high power efficiency, the RT9193-15PU5 offers a low dropout voltage of just 200mV at 300mA load current, making it ideal for battery-powered devices, portable electronics, and embedded systems. Its ultra-low quiescent current of 65μA (typical) further enhances energy efficiency, extending battery life in power-conscious applications.  

Engineers will appreciate the regulator’s fast transient response and excellent line/load regulation, ensuring stable performance even under dynamic operating conditions. With built-in protection features such as thermal shutdown and current limiting, the RT9193-15PU5 safeguards sensitive circuits against potential faults.  

Housed in a compact **SOT-23-5** package, this LDO is perfect for space-constrained designs without compromising performance. Whether used in IoT devices, wearables, or precision analog circuits, the RT9193-15PU5 delivers consistent, low-noise power with minimal external components required.
